Sejwahi Village

Sejwahi is an inhabited village in Manpur Sub-district of Umaria district, Madhya Pradesh. Its Census village code is 467919, the Census 2011 record lists 774 people in 191 households and the reported area is 1,453.24 hectares. The local references include Manpur CD Block and the nearest town reference is Umaria at about 60 km.

Population and Social Groups

The Census 2011 record lists 774 people in 191 households, with 408 male residents and 366 female residents. The average household size is 4.05, and SC share is 0.65% and ST share is 66.67% for Sejwahi. Population density works out to about 53.26 people per sq km.

Land Use and Local Economy

Land-use records for Sejwahi show that net sown area is 85 hectares and irrigated land is 48.14 hectares (56.6% of net sown area). These figures help explain village agriculture and local economy context.
